I'm running dual MSI R4870X2 cards in CrossFire and don't get any CrossFire configuration/diagnostic options in the CCC. All I get is a checkbox to enable CrossFire.
It was my understanding that CCC allows you to choose a rendering technique but this doesn't seem to be the case.
However, CrossFire is definitely working as I get a much higher score on 3DMark Vantage compared to having CrossFire disabled.
I'm using the latest drivers from the MSI site, which is 8.501 - 2008-08-07.
Set up:
Asus Rampage Extreme
Intel Q9650 @ 4.06 GHz
4 GB Corsair Dominator RAM @ 1800MHz
2x 4870X2 OC Edition
Vista 64 bit
Corsair 1000W PSU
Score on 3DMark Vantage:
Without CrossFire: 15739
With CrossFire: 21089
Is there something I'm missing with the setting up of CrossFire?!
